Hello,
ln(y)=ln(x^(ln(x))=ln(x)*ln(x)=(ln(x))²
(ln(y))'=2ln(x)*1/x
(1/y)*y'=2ln(x) / x
y'=(2 ln(x) * x^(ln(x)) ) /x
